最近带的新人试用期到了就自己离职了,临走前单独请我吃了个饭。因为我让他知道自己不适合做开发。所以我是怎么带新人的呢?
新人刚来我会先跟他讲业务,业务大致了解后就开始参与具体模块的开发。
参与开发的第一步就是阅读代码。我一般都把人安排坐我旁边,有什么问题随时问,我随时回答。我的要求是工程要能自己跑起来,每一条语句都要看懂,每个判断语句只要看不懂为什么这么判断,就一定要问我。我可以让你看代码看一个月。涉及到不懂的基础知识和框架的,自己学;涉及到业务逻辑相关的问题,我来解答。
总之,新人越是自觉,我就越配合,通常不到一个月就可以动手改代码,到试用期结束,该模块只要不是设计变更都可以交给新人做了。
否则的话,试用期结束了还什么都做不了,都不用公司赶人,自己都知道走掉。
所以一个人是不是对技术感兴趣,很容易看出来,就是问得勤不勤快。问得越勤快,说明进入开发角色就越快。
回头说刚离职的那位,基本上就什么都不问。以前没接触过的东西,比如 Spring Boot,学得特别吃力。这种人要是留在公司,那不叫带了,那要拼命扯。我是没那么多精力。毕竟我也是打工的,我做的一切也不过是为了我自己。
1
CODEWEA 2018-09-25 22:02:36 +08:00 1
所以 文档也没有?
|
2
wdlth 2018-09-25 22:04:07 +08:00
没有相应的培训体系么?
|
3
yidinghe OP |
4
storypanda 2018-09-25 22:25:42 +08:00 via Android
我目前在做新媒体运营,公司分享恰好有 spring boot,我就去听了,我司试用期六个月,没干几天就像转岗了,尝试技术。
|
5
CruelMoon 2018-09-25 22:26:52 +08:00 1
一直问的话不会觉得烦吗?因为没办法集中精力做自己的事情。
偶也怀疑这种口口相传的开发模式....在这种模式下,假设一位像楼主一样的大佬大佬不幸感冒失声,人们就无从得知业务逻辑,团队的工作没法进行下去,未免有点不安全 |
6
storypanda 2018-09-25 22:29:06 +08:00 via Android
上面叫我写娱乐八卦,我不追星,我可写不出来。
而且现在的单位是我家人叫我进去的,不然一直在自学开发了。 很纠结,每天看明星看微博都要吐了。 今天新人分享的是 spring boot 和 vue,vue。确实要比 jQuery 方便得多,不用关心 DOM,只管逻辑业务。 spring boot 最新的 3-4.x 是用 Java 配置,使用 @target...进行指定数据库的.. |
7
0044200420 2018-09-25 22:30:50 +08:00
我是随他看不看代码,刚来只做新功能,不会让修 bug,做到哪看到哪,由点到面慢慢熟悉。还有我会说明,随你白天高效搬砖准点跑路或者划水加班,反正别让我擦屁股就行
|
8
closedevice 2018-09-25 22:36:44 +08:00 1
不敢苟同,问的勤不勤快并不说明问题.之前带过爱问的也带过那种闷声的,并没有什么区别.就带新人而言,重要的是先说明技术背景以及业务演化历程,通常这在招聘环节需要和应聘者进行交流.如果人招进来,却对当前技术方案接受困难,那很显然是招聘者在招聘环节出现问题了.另外,我觉得没有所谓不适合做开发的人,只有在某方面不擅长的人.带新人更重要的不是发现其不擅长的,而是让他发挥自己擅长的.
|
9
DAPTX4869 2018-09-25 22:40:57 +08:00
我咋遇不上这样的上司咧...问问题的时候让我怼源码...
|
10
lucky2javascript 2018-09-26 00:29:29 +08:00
只要智商正常的人干开发都没问题吧
|
11
kx5d62Jn1J9MjoXP 2018-09-26 00:35:59 +08:00 via Android 5
误人子弟还沾沾自喜
Java 那一套 web 后端本来就不好学 |
12
YvesX 2018-09-26 01:11:55 +08:00 7
依我观察,学习能力强的人往往不爱轻易问人。(倒过来不一定)
用问不问得勤快来判断稍微有点扯,要那些动辄扔出《提问的智慧》的人打一架。 话说回来,技术宅的刻板印象不是闷声搞黑科技吗…… 但比起评判标准,我更觉得,淘汰这件事不该是楼主来做。 |
14
scnace 2018-09-26 01:59:31 +08:00 via Android 1
一般代码上有记录的都不会轻易问别人 除非自己花了一个小时还没有理解的业务逻辑才会去问……
|
15
laxenade 2018-09-26 02:01:32 +08:00 via Android 2
所以这就是你不写文档的理由?
|
16
TabGre 2018-09-26 07:25:21 +08:00 via iPhone
妈蛋,进来一周不到就开始做模块,放养,没人管
|
17
ChenJHua 2018-09-26 08:06:11 +08:00 via iPhone
要我遇到这样的,学啥?直接跑路
|
18
zhangZMZ 2018-09-26 08:13:24 +08:00
据我所知,国内外的大佬一般文档都 6,写不好文档的注释也写不好。注释都写不好这,,,,。
目前好像没有只会写代码的大佬,只会写代码不是低级码农吗?比如刚毕业的我!!! |
19
Coande 2018-09-26 08:46:02 +08:00
遇到不会利用搜索解决问题只知道问的你就知道错了
|
20
mxtob 2018-09-26 08:53:00 +08:00 via Android
觉得一般做一个业务 有基本的逻辑思考,其中某些点偏差了没事,有些人连懂都不懂,那就没救了,大多数人都可以开发
|
21
loongwang 2018-09-26 08:59:01 +08:00
@0044200420 emm 那我是要被打死了,已经坑了好几次了
|
22
chocotan 2018-09-26 09:01:20 +08:00
好几个回答都是没仔细看楼主说的就把楼主批判一番
spring boot 算是很好学的吧,业务逻辑上的问题不问等着拖到明年? |
23
LeungV2 2018-09-26 09:08:04 +08:00
等一个 新人是怎么带我的
|
24
a1640440622 2018-09-26 11:47:34 +08:00
老哥 还带人吗
|
25
Evoque 2018-09-26 12:14:30 +08:00
统一楼主, 最近也带了个新人, 情商太 tm 低。 带一段之后还是自生自灭吧, 谁都不可能追着让你学。
|
26
dbdd 2018-09-26 12:25:04 +08:00
新人上 V2EX 吗
|
27
green15 2018-09-26 12:34:38 +08:00 via iPhone
楼主这种做法不是叫带新人,而是不会带人。
|
28
tachikomachann 2018-09-26 12:37:12 +08:00 via Android
业务上的事情可以多问,技术上的事情,给关键词让他自己查
|
29
loryyang 2018-09-26 12:40:40 +08:00
我认为要加上一条,对知识的 search 能力。大一些的公司会有许多的文档和代码。你可以从这些资源中找到有价值的,然后获取知识。如果有问题,那么首先看是否去尝试寻找了
|
30
s609926202 2018-09-26 12:45:56 +08:00 via iPhone
有个能问问题的前辈真好,我找我司运维解决 ELB 获取 IP 的问题,直接让我去看什么是 HTTP1.1,我去 TM 的比~这有个锤子关系,害我被领导说办事不力。
|
31
sampeng 2018-09-26 13:52:52 +08:00
扔那看代码?随口问?楼上也说了,问的不勤的人才是能力有潜力的,问的勤快潜力两说。
新人来了直接给需求,自己做去。做不出来咱们再一个个拆解问题在哪。告知如何解决问题和解决问题的办法就行了。比如指导搭个梯子,自己上 google 查。有什么问题,直接甩关键词自己去搜。都是打工的,没有义务手把手教。 楼主这样带人。。。。差点意思。感觉是在享受被问的快感。 |
32
sampeng 2018-09-26 13:53:40 +08:00
正儿八经带出来的新人,不是试用期后可以改代码。那太 low 了。。是试用期后可以直接接需求做一个独立开发了。
|
33
liuzhen 2018-09-27 12:24:03 +08:00
文档?不知道楼上那些都是什么大厂的 说的文档该不会是什么详细设计、系统设计.doc 吧
近几年待过的中小公司基本设计文档就是每个模块画个 UML 图 系统交互也是画图 图里包含数据库字段 注释在代码注解里头 其他文档就 swagger 生成的 api 文档了 |
34
AslanFong 2018-10-04 11:01:01 +08:00
所以你们没有自己的 wiki 么 ?
|